POLICE SEEK PUBLIC’S HELP IN LOCATING ARMED ROBBERY SUSPECT

Nassau, Bahamas - Reports are that shortly after 4:30pm on Monday 19th January 2015, a man armed with a handgun robbed a business establishment located on Robinson Road of a small amount of cash before fleeing on foot.

Investigations are ongoing.

POLICE SEEK PUBLIC’S HELP IN SHOOTING INCIDENT

Reports are that shortly after 10:00pm on Monday 19th January 2015, police received a report that a man was shot on Soldier Road in the area of Churchill Subdivision. Officers on arrival at the scene met an adult male suffering from gunshot wounds to the body. The victim was transported to hospital, where he remains in stable condition.

Investigations are ongoing.
